These are pictures of a dice bag a family member ordered as a gift for a friend.  Oooo the regal richness of the array of crimson hues contrasting with the fulvous magnificence of golden accents. The variegated cotton threads used to create this bag of beauty provide a sumptuous palate of color and texture. 




This is a full circle mandala of texture and vibrant color, lovingly and painstaking crocheted from size 12 crochet thread. Next the lining was crafted from upcycled cotton jersey knit (one of my favorite Ts). The diamond center was painted using acrylic fabric paint, and a celestial motif of golden stars playfully dances across the rich maroon plane. The lining was handsewn in place, and theproject was finished as the hand-crocheted drawstrings were woven through to create the neck of the bag.






These are not colors i usually work with, so the project was a personal exploration and a great adventure.  We were all VERY pleased with the result.
